Transaction d593fad138e3f72819adae95c7993494fa95e42af932289ae238d99e14f921d7
1 Input
1 Outputs
- d593fad138e3f72819adae95c7993494fa95e42af932289ae238d99e14f921d7:0
value 563
address 1HuTLdrhq2cTnewPt53qjGBjYniKTPVNFH